在数字化时代,云服务器已经成为个人和企业不可或缺的一部分。AlmaLinux是一款基于CentOS的免费开源操作系统,它继承了CentOS的稳定性和可靠性,同时提供了更多的选择和灵活性。对于新手来说,使用AlmaLinux部署云服务器可能是一个挑战,但通过以下步骤,即使是新手也能轻松完成。
1. 选择云服务提供商
首先,你需要选择一个云服务提供商。市面上有很多知名的云服务提供商,如阿里云、腾讯云、华为云等。选择云服务提供商时,需要考虑以下因素:
- 价格:比较不同提供商的价格,包括服务器实例、存储和带宽等。
- 性能:查看服务器的性能指标,如CPU、内存和存储速度等。
- 稳定性:了解服务提供商的口碑和服务质量。
- 地域:选择距离你最近的数据中心,以降低延迟。
2. 注册并购买云服务器
完成选择后,你需要注册并登录到云服务提供商的官网。以下是注册和购买云服务器的步骤:
- 注册账号:在官网注册一个新的账号。
- 选择套餐:根据你的需求选择合适的云服务器套餐。
- 配置服务器:配置服务器的CPU、内存、存储和带宽等。
- 购买:确认配置无误后,进行支付。
3. 登录云服务器
购买完成后,你将获得服务器的公网IP地址和登录凭证。以下是登录云服务器的步骤:
- 使用SSH客户端:使用SSH客户端(如PuTTY)连接到服务器。
- 输入用户名和密码:输入你在云服务提供商处设置的登录用户名和密码。
4. 安装AlmaLinux
登录到服务器后,你可以开始安装AlmaLinux。以下是一个简单的安装步骤:
# 更新系统
sudo dnf update -y
# 安装AlmaLinux
sudo dnf install almalinux-release -y
# 安装必要的依赖
sudo dnf groupinstall -y "AlmaLinux Base Group"
# 安装图形界面(可选)
sudo dnf groupinstall -y "AlmaLinux Desktop Group"
5. 配置云服务器
安装完成后,你需要配置云服务器以满足你的需求。以下是一些常见的配置任务:
- 设置静态IP地址:如果你的云服务器使用的是动态IP地址,你可以设置静态IP地址以保持网络连接的稳定性。
- 安装Apache或Nginx:如果你需要托管网站,你可以安装Apache或Nginx。
- 安装数据库:如果你需要运行应用程序,你可以安装数据库,如MySQL或PostgreSQL。
- 安装安全软件:为了保护你的云服务器,你需要安装安全软件,如Fail2Ban和ClamAV。
6. 测试云服务器
配置完成后,你需要测试云服务器以确保一切正常。以下是一些测试步骤:
- 访问网站:如果你安装了Apache或Nginx,你可以通过浏览器访问你的网站。
- 运行应用程序:如果你安装了数据库,你可以尝试运行你的应用程序。
- 检查性能:使用工具(如
top和htop)检查服务器的性能。
通过以上步骤,你将能够使用AlmaLinux轻松部署云服务器。记住,云服务器管理是一个持续的过程,你需要不断学习和适应新的技术和工具。祝你部署顺利!
